Flawless D 2025 Limited-Time Sale
Flawless D 2025
★★★★★
4.9 (285)
$65.00
Latest Collection Flawless D 2025 Jumbo
Catalog No. 91978789
Flawless D 2025 Limited-Time Sale
$65.00
Latest Collection Flawless D 2025 Jumbo
Catalog No. 91978789